Quantum information science, mainly containing quantum computation and quantum communication, is an innovative subject combining quantum mechanics and classical information science. The birth of quantum information science provides a new space for the development of information science. As an indispensable physical resource, quantum entanglement has been widely applied in the field of quantum information. However, during the practical information transmission, processing, or storage, the inevitable interaction between qubit and noisy environment would lead to the quantum decoherence. So, how to protect the quantum entanglement effectively becomes a research focus. For now, many effective methods have been suggested, such as decoherence-free subspace, dynamic decoupling, quantum error correction, quantum Zeno effects and so on.In this thesis, entanglement restoration schemes are proposed for the maximally two-qubit entangled state via environment-assisted and weak measurement reversal. According to the transmission of qubits, the schemes could be divided into three categories:sending one qubit, two qubits, and sending two qubits but restoring a qubit. The high fidelity of quantum entanglement can be probabilistically obtained between two remote participants via the environment-assisted coupling with quan-tum states and the weak measurement reversal. And the maximally entangled state can be probabilistically obtained with the optimal value of weak measurement re-versal in this scheme. In some specific cases, the maximally entangled states could also be probabilistically obtained even without the weak measurement reversal. In addition, we propose the quantum telepotation between two remote participants can be realized with high fidelity using environment-assisted weak measurement.
